Description
Join Stryker as a Staff Engineer supporting New Product Introduction (NPI) and biologics process development. This role provides technical leadership across process design, validation, manufacturing readiness, and supplier collaboration to ensure biologics processes are developed, controlled, and documented in compliance with applicable quality and regulatory requirements. You will work across cross-functional teams to advance new product launches while maintaining a strong focus on process robustness, product quality, and operational excellence.
What You Will Do
Lead the development, optimization, and control of upstream and downstream biologics manufacturing processes across internal and supplier operations.
Conduct process characterization, variability, hold-time, and worst-case condition studies to establish process robustness and define in-process control strategies.
Evaluate, select, and qualify manufacturing equipment and components based on technical specifications, reliability requirements, and applicable regulations; support equipment installation and validation activities.
Generate and review technical documentation including PFMEAs, Control Plans, SOPs, PPAPs, validation protocols, capability studies, MSA studies, and inspection documentation to support product launches.
Mentor engineers, provide technical guidance across multiple product portfolios, and deliver technical updates and recommendations to stakeholders and leadership.
What You Will Need
Required:
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ical Engineering or a related engineering discipline.
Minimum 7 years of engineering experience in manufacturing, process development, product development, or a related field.
Minimum 7 years of experience supporting regulated manufacturing environments.
Experience developing and validating manufacturing processes, including statistical analysis and verification/validation methodologies.
Experience interpreting engineering drawings, specifications, and geometric dimensioning and tolerancing (GD&T).
Experience with Design for Manufacturing (DFM), process capability studies, and measurement system analysis (MSA).
Preferred:
Experience supporting biologics manufacturing or biologics process development.
Experience in FDA-regulated or ISO 13485-regulated industries and supporting complex global supply chains.
